Impact of the COVID-19 pandemic on breast cancer mortality in the US: estimates from collaborative simulation modeling.
This study’s objective was to project the impact of COVID-19 on future breast cancer mortality between 2020 and 2030. Three established Cancer Intervention and Surveillance Modeling Network breast cancer models were used to model reductions in mammography screening use, delays in symptomatic cancer diagnosis, and reduced use of chemotherapy for women with early-stage disease for the first 6 months of the pandemic with return to prepandemic patterns after that time. The models project by 2030 950 cumulative excess breast cancers deaths related to reduced screening, 1314 deaths associated with delayed diagnosis of symptomatic cases, and 151 deaths associated with reduced chemotherapy use in women with hormone positive, early-stage cancer.

Neighborhood walkability and mortality in a prospective cohort of women.
The purpose of this study was to evaluate neighborhood walkability in relation to the risk of death for women. Participants were recruited in New York City from 1985 to 1991 and tracked for an average of 27 years. Researchers also conducted survival analyses using Cox proportional hazards models to assess association between neighborhood walkability and the risk of death from any cause. Results indicated that residence neighborhoods with higher walkability scores was associated with a lower mortality rate. No association was found between neighborhood walkability and risk of death from cardiometabolic diseases, but exploratory analyses suggested that outdoor walking and average BMI mediated the association between neighborhood walkability and mortality.

Black-white disparities in maternal in-hospital mortality according to teaching and black-serving hospital status.
This study’s objective was to determine whether black-white disparities in maternal in-hospital mortality during delivery vary across hospital types (black-serving vs non-black and teaching vs non-teaching) and whether overall maternal mortality differs across hospital types. The authors performed a population-based, retrospective cohort study of 5,679,044 deliveries among black (14.2%) and white patients (85.8%) in 3 states (California, Missouri, and Pennsylvania) from 1995 to 2009. Examination of black-white disparities found that after risk adjustment, black patients had significantly greater risk of death and that the disparity was similar within each of the hospital types. At teaching hospitals, mortality was similar in black-serving and nonblack-serving hospitals. Among non-teaching hospitals, mortality was significantly higher in black-serving vs nonblack-serving hospitals. Over half (53%) of black patients delivered in nonteaching black-serving hospitals compared with just 19% of white patients.
